Tucker Reynolds

Tucker Reynolds

Born and raised on the Emerald Coast, Tucker has been in the water from a young age. This passion for the water drove him to get his B.S in Marine Biology from the University of West Florida. During his time there, he did an aquaculture internship on an oyster farm, which helped grow his appreciation for oysters and the restoration work they can provide.

Before joining CBA, Tucker spent time interning with the Pensacola and Perdido Bays Estuary Program, where he helped increase manatee awareness within Northwest Florida. At CBA, Tucker is in charge of Oyster Recycling and Oyster Gardening programs, and spends a lot of time on the water with our Monitoring Team.

His hobbies include fishing, diving, and being outdoors.
